G. E. Ballester is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Instrumentation and Atmospheric Science.
According to data from OpenAlex, G. E. Ballester has authored 136 papers receiving a total of 8.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 131 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 31 papers in Instrumentation and 13 papers in Atmospheric Science. Recurrent topics in G. E. Ballester’s work include Astro and Planetary Science (92 papers),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(84 papers) and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(53 papers). G. E. Ballester is often cited by papers focused on Astro and Planetary Science (92 papers),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(84 papers) and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(53 papers). G. E. Ballester coll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and United Kingdom. G. E. Ballester's co-authors include John T. Trauger, J. T. Clarke, David K. Sing, David Crisp and Karl R. Stapelfeldt and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res.
